Output 526e2059f9b9230496f410ec4341683188c23d9d28dd2c54c2d735f77b6191e5:1

value
8496598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 764cf837f9f7b03edec606c2938d5e201bf8523c OP_EQUAL
address
3CUXs81J99DLsCf1dHUdF599zksgBGRP3U
transaction
526e2059f9b9230496f410ec4341683188c23d9d28dd2c54c2d735f77b6191e5
spent
true